A23181014007992 RIGHT
A23181013007992 LEFT
The last 4 digits are the color of the part.

I changed the mirror cover in the car workshop.
This is a description from a German site
Installation is as follows:
- Swing the mirror all the way down and pull it off from above, if necessary slightly raise the mirror holder with a hoe
- The mirror heater and if necessary. Disconnect the blind spot warning cable
- Loosen two small screws that fix the lower part
- Remove the upper part of the mirror by loosening the latch over the motor (this is a bit difficult if you have no experience)
- Disconnect the plug connection of the previous LED from the lower part of the mirror
- Now clip out the lower part of the mirror and remove it
- Clip in the new mirror base, screw in two screws and create the wiring (plugs fit before / after 1: 1)
- Put the upper part of the mirror back on, here attention with regard to the plug of the turn signal lamp
- Restore the mirror wiring and reinsert the mirror
Time expenditure:
It took me about 25 minutes, but I had no experience with mirror removal.
Finished.
